feat: add observability and CLI enhancements
Audit logging:
- audit_log table with event tracking
- app/audit.py module with log_event(), query_audit_log()
- GET /audit endpoint (admin only)
- configurable retention and cleanup

Prometheus metrics:
- app/metrics.py with custom counters
- paste create/access/delete, rate limit, PoW, dedup metrics
- instrumentation in API routes

CLI clipboard integration:
- fpaste create -C/--clipboard (read from clipboard)
- fpaste create --copy-url (copy result URL)
- fpaste get -c/--copy (copy content)
- cross-platform: xclip, xsel, pbcopy, wl-copy

Shell completions:
- completions/ directory with bash/zsh/fish scripts
- fpaste completion --shell command
